Chris Hemsworth Kundli
Chris Hemsworth’s available Kundli profile is a date-only, Vedic Lahiri sidereal reading for 11 August 1983 in Melbourne, Australia. The chart data provides stable sign and nakshatra placements for the Sun, Mercury, Venus, Mars, Jupiter, Saturn, Rahu, and Ketu, but it does not provide a birth time, ascendant, houses, vargas, time-sensitive yogas, or dashas. Within those limits, the pattern emphasizes expressive visibility, emotional intensity, disciplined presentation, relational magnetism, and a tension between familiar emotional instincts and exploratory growth. The profile is interpretive rather than predictive and does not make claims about health, death, private relationships, or future events.

Chart overview
The calculation is explicitly marked date-only and uses a Vedic Lahiri sidereal profile with Swiss Ephemeris data. The birth time is unknown, so the system sampled the local date at 15-minute intervals and retained placements considered stable across those samples. This gives a useful planetary outline without pretending to know the ascendant or house structure.
The stable placements are: Sun in Cancer in Ashlesha; Mercury in Leo in Purva Phalguni; Venus in Leo in Purva Phalguni; Mars in Cancer in Pushya; Jupiter in Scorpio in Anuradha; Saturn in Libra in Chitra; Rahu in Taurus in Mrigashira; and Ketu in Scorpio in Jyeshtha. These placements create a notable blend of water and fire symbolism. Cancer and Scorpio emphasize feeling, protectiveness, depth, and emotional memory, while Leo contributes performance, style, confidence, and a desire to communicate with presence. Libra Saturn adds a strong principle of form, balance, and refinement.

Planetary evidence
The Sun in Cancer, in Ashlesha, places the central identity principle in a sign associated in traditional astrology with sensitivity, protection, belonging, and receptivity. Ashlesha adds a more concentrated, perceptive, and psychologically observant tone. Interpreted conservatively, this can describe a public persona that is not merely outwardly visible but capable of conveying guarded intensity and emotional subtext.
Mercury and Venus are both in Leo and both in Purva Phalguni. Mercury in Leo supports communication that is declarative, vivid, and shaped for an audience. Venus in the same sign and nakshatra adds aesthetic confidence, theatrical warmth, and an appreciation for presentation. Their shared placement creates a coherent signature: speech, style, and personal appeal can reinforce one another rather than operate as separate qualities. This is especially relevant to work involving performance or visual presence.
Mars in Cancer, in Pushya, gives action a protective or emotionally invested quality. Mars here is not interpreted as a prediction of behavior; rather, it suggests that initiative may be expressed through loyalty, defense, persistence, or care for an established base. Jupiter in Scorpio, in Anuradha, adds depth, commitment, and an ability to engage with material that requires emotional seriousness or sustained concentration.
Saturn in Libra, in Chitra, combines discipline with proportion, design, and visible structure. This is a placement that can be read as valuing craft, balance, and the shaping of an effective external form. Rahu in Taurus, in Mrigashira, points symbolically toward experimentation with tangible value, style, comfort, and sensory presentation. Ketu in Scorpio, in Jyeshtha, gives the opposite pole a self-contained, penetrating, and less easily satisfied quality. Together, the nodes frame a movement between building concrete appeal and retaining psychological depth.

Soma analysis
In Jyotish terminology, Soma is commonly associated with the Moon: nourishment, receptivity, emotional rhythm, imagination, and the subjective experience of life. A responsible Soma analysis therefore requires a verified lunar sign, nakshatra, and ideally a timed chart context. Those data are not present in the supplied deterministic placements. The listed stable placements include the Sun, Mercury, Venus, Mars, Jupiter, Saturn, Rahu, and Ketu, but no Moon placement.
Because the Moon is absent, this profile cannot assign a Soma sign, Moon nakshatra, lunar dignity, tithi-based interpretation, Chandra-related yoga, or house placement. It also cannot infer emotional habits from a substitute planet. The Cancer and Scorpio placements may be discussed as water-sign symbolism, but they must not be relabeled as lunar evidence. Likewise, the Ashlesha, Pushya, Anuradha, and Jyeshtha nakshatras belong to the listed planets and cannot be treated as the subject’s Moon nakshatra.
The most accurate Soma conclusion is therefore methodological: the chart offers meaningful non-lunar evidence about sensitivity, intensity, and protection, but a genuine lunar analysis remains undetermined. This restraint is important because Soma is often overinterpreted when birth data are incomplete.
